Samsung Galaxy S8 Factory Reset Protection
Adding a Google Account to your device automatically activates the Factory Reset Protection (FRP) Galaxy S8 security feature.

Disable Factory Reset Protection
To disable FRP, remove all Google Accounts from the device.
  1. From a Home screen, swipe up to access Apps.
  2. Tap Settings > Accounts > Google.
  3. If you have more than one Google Account set up on your device, tap the Google Account you want to remove.
  4. Tap More options > Remove account.

Samsung Galaxy S8 Reset Settings

Reset device and network settings. You can also reset your device to its factory defaults. You can reset your device to its factory default settings, which resets everything except the security, language, and account settings. Personal data is not affected. Galaxy S8 reset settings instructions:
  1. From a Home screen, swipe up to access Apps.
  2. Tap Settings > Backup and reset > Reset settings.
  3. Tap Reset settings, and confirm when prompted
Reset Network Settings
You can reset Wi-Fi, Mobile data, and Bluetooth settings with Reset network settings.
  1. From a Home screen, swipe up to access Apps.
  2. Tap Settings > Backup and reset > Reset network settings.
  3. Tap Reset settings, and confirm when prompted.

Galaxy S8 Factory Data Reset

You can reset your Galaxy S8 factory reset to defaults, erasing all data from your device. This action permanently erases ALL data from the device, including Google or other account settings, system and application data and settings, downloaded applications, as well as your music, photos, videos, and other files. Any data stored on an external SD card is not affected. When you sign in to a Google Account on your device, Factory Reset Protection is activated. This protects your device in the event it is lost or stolen.

If you reset Galaxy S8 to factory default settings with the Galaxy S8 Factory Reset Protection (FRP) feature activated, you must enter the user name and password for a registered Google Account to regain access to the device. You will not be able to access the device without the correct credentials. If you reset your Google Account password, it can take 24 hours for the password reset to sync with all devices registered to the account.

Galaxy S8 Tips
Before resetting Galaxy S8:
  1. Verify that the information you want to keep has transferred to your storage area.
  2. Log in to your Google Account and confirm your user name and password
Galaxy S8 Manual To reset your device:
  1. From a Home screen, swipe up to access Apps.
  2. Tap Settings > Backup and reset > Factory data reset.
  3. Tap Reset and follow the prompts to perform the reset.
  4. When the device restarts, follow the prompts to set up your device.

Galaxy S8 Hard Reset

Master Reset Galaxy S8/S8+If your device is frozen and unresponsive, you can do Galaxy S8 Hard Reset to Reset S8 by following this S8 guide:
  • Press and hold the Power key and the Volume Down key simultaneously for more than 7 seconds to restart it.
